Overview Material Control Specialists are responsible for managing the flow of materials and supplies in a business or organization. They are responsible for ensuring that materials are ordered, stored, and distributed in a timely and efficient manner. They also ensure that materials are properly tracked and accounted for. Detailed Job Description Material Control Specialists are responsible for managing the flow of materials and supplies in a business or organization. They are responsible for ordering, receiving, storing, and distributing materials in a timely and efficient manner. They must ensure that materials are properly tracked and accounted for. They must also ensure that materials are stored in a safe and secure manner. Additionally, they must ensure that materials are delivered to the appropriate locations in a timely manner.
